Enter Mitro Access, a brand new solution from a group of previous Bing workers, that allows one to ask friends and family into the online life that is dating. Here is how it operates, based on a test run by ABC News: it makes a link that is unique send to buddies, which provides them usage of your on line dating profile to modify and star other users. (ABC Information tested the application via an OkCupid profile.) Your pals can browse matches, improve your settings, and edit the answers in your profile, nevertheless they can not really content individuals. I have for ages been a massive
